Latest Jobs

TRAFFIC England, Not Specified, United Kingdom 17h ago
The Opportunity The Head of Performance Marketing will lead and scale the company's digital acquisition engine, driving growth across all paid channels while optimising for ROI and customer lifetime value. This is both a...
17h ago
Apply
Clicky